Our mission is to provide compassionate care and brighter futures for homeless animals.
We commit to the following:
Provide a safe haven for homeless and lost animals
Reunite lost pets with their owners
Place animals in our care in qualified, loving homes
Reduce pet overpopulation with spay/neuter education and assistance
Advise and advocate for the protection of animals
Network with other shelters and pet rescue groups impacted by overcrowding or natural disasters to decrease euthanasia rates and ultimately save lives
Advance animal welfare through education, outreach, and assistance
Promote a stronger sense of the animal/human bond
Always adhere to our no-kill philosophy for adoptable animals
